Texas A&M fans took their posts in the form of large maroon masses outside of Kyle Field Stadium, College Station, Sunday afternoon.
Unknown to the Aggies, the Mustangs were about to make their grand entrance.
Three hours away, 500 SMU students were loading seven charter buses, for the road trip to “Aggieland.”
“I wanted one of my first presidential activities to include a pairing of students and the SMU Athletic Department,” SMU Student Body President, Austin Prentice said. “I met with Steve Orsini and Brad Sutton to share my road trip vision. They both hopped on board and One28 helped with the manpower and logistics this.”
